Christophe Mboso N'Kodia Pwanga (o o tshotsweng ka Phatwe a le malatsi a supa ngwaga wa 1942) ke mopolotiki kwa kwa Congo o e neng e le tautona wa palamente go tswa ka Tlhakole 2021 go tsena Motsheganong 2024, gompieno ke mothusa tautona wa bobedi.[1][2][3] O eteletse pele setlhopha sa polotiki sa Action of Allies of the Convention for the Republic and Democracy.[4]

A tshotswe ka 1942, o alogile ka 1972 ka bachelor's degree ya polotiki go tswa kwa University of Lubumbashi.[5] Ka Tlhakole 2021, o ne a tlhophiwa go nna tautona wa palamente morago ga ditlhopho tse a amogetseng ditlhopho di le makgolo a mararo, masome a robabobedi le borobabongwe go tswa mo batlhophing ba le makgolo a mane, masome a marataro. O ne a tlhatlhama Jeannine Mabunda o o kobilweng ka Morule a le lesome ngwaga wa 2020.[1]
